About 58 Filton Grove
58 Filton Grove is a one-bedroom end-of-terrace house in Bristol (BS7 0AL). It has a recorded floor area of 50 m² (around 538 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(February 2015) shows a D (score 67),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The rating has held steady at D across 2 certificates since December 2014. Between certificates, hot-water efficiency went from Average to Good; while lighting dropped from Very Good to Good.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 75). The latest certificate is from February 2015, so improvements made since then won't be reflected. At 50 m² this is the 4th smallest of 23 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 43–132 m². The building's EPC ratings span E to B across 23 units on file.
It hasn't traded since November 2002, a hold of 24 years that's notably long for the area. Today's modelled estimate of £230,000 sits 67.9% above the 2002 sale of £137,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£255/sq ft) was about 19% above the typical sold price in the postcode. At 50 m² it sits well below the postcode median (92 m² across 22 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ally. 2 planning records sit against the property, 2 approved, 0 refused. Past consents include an extension and subdivision,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ved.
